Ingredients for Fall Pumpkin Spice Roll Cake
- 1 cup all-purpose flour: Light and airy, providing the perfect base for your cake.
- 1/2 tsp baking powder: Ensures your cake has the right lift and fluffiness.
- 1/2 tsp baking soda: Helps the cake rise, giving it that light texture.
- 1 tsp ground cinnamon: Adds warmth and a hint of spice.
- 2 tsp pumpkin pie spice blend: Infuses the cake with the essence of fall.
- 1/4 tsp salt: Enhances the sweetness of the cake.
- 3 large eggs: Binds the ingredients together while helping the cake rise.
- 1-1/4 cups granulated sugar: Delivers sweet, moist goodness.
- 1 cup canned pumpkin puree: The star ingredient, adding flavor and moisture.
- 1 tsp vanilla extract: A touches of sweetness that complements the spices.
- 1/4 cup powdered sugar: For dusting the towel, ensuring a non-stick unrolling process.
- 8 oz cream cheese, at room temperature: Adds a creamy richness to the frosting.
- 1/4 cup salted butter, softened: Contributes to a decadent frosting texture.
- 1 tsp vanilla extract: Complements the frosting for added flavor.
- 1/8 tsp ground cinnamon: A touch of spice to the frosting.
- Pinch of sea salt: Balances the sweetness.
- 3 cups powdered sugar: For that sweet frosting finish.
Step-by-Step Directions for Fall Pumpkin Spice Roll Cake
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) to ensure your cake bakes evenly and thoroughly.
- Line a 15×10-inch jelly roll pan with parchment paper and grease it lightly to prevent sticking.
- In a b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, ground cinnamon, pumpkin pie spice blend, and salt until evenly mixed for that perfect spiced base.
- In another bowl, whisk together the eggs and granulated sugar until light and fluffy, creating a comforting and airy texture. Stir in the pumpkin puree and vanilla extract until the mixture is smooth and velvety.
- Gradually f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ture without overmixing to maintain the cake’s fluffy consistency.
- Pour the batter into the prepared pan and ensure it spreads evenly. Bake for 15-20 minutes until a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
- Once baked, turn the cake onto a powdered sugar-dusted towel and carefully remove the parchment paper for a smooth finish.
- Roll the cake with the towel to cool completely, creating the roll shape while it’s still warm, ensuring it maintains form.
- For the frosting, blend the cream cheese and butter until smooth. Then, add in the vanilla extract, ground cinnamon, sea salt, and powdered sugar, mixing until fluffy.
- Unroll the cake, spread frosting evenly over it, and then gently roll it back up, encasing the creamy filling in the moist cake.
- Chill for at least 30 minutes before slicing and serving to allow the flavors to meld and the frosting to set.
Tips & Tricks
- Chef’s Secrets: For an extra depth of flavor, consider toasting the spices before adding them to the mixture.
- Optional Extras: A handful of chopped nuts, such as walnuts or pecans, can add a delightful crunch.
- Cooking Hacks: If you don’t have a jelly roll pan, a similar-sized baking dish works just fine. Just ensure it has sides to hold the batter.
- Serving Style: A dusting of powdered sugar on top before serving can add an elegant touch.

Storing Tips & Variations for Fall Pumpkin Spice Roll Cake
To keep your Fall Pumpkin Spice Roll Cake fresh, store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to five days. If you want to enjoy it later, consider freezing the prepared rolls. Simply wrap them tightly in plastic wrap and aluminum foil to protect against freezer burn. When ready to enjoy, let it thaw in the refrigerator overnight. For variations, try substituting the cream cheese frosting with a yogurt-based frosting for a lighter option, or experiment with differing spices to create your unique take.

FAQs
1. Can I make this cake 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the cake a day ahead of serving. Just store it in the refrigerator wrapped tightly to maintain freshness.
2. What can I use instead of canned pumpkin puree?
You can make your own pumpkin puree by roasting and blending fresh pumpkin. Alternatively, butternut squash puree works well too.
3. How do I know when the cake is done?
The cake is done when a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ean or with just a few crumbs attached.
4. Can I use different spices?
Definitely! Feel free to adjust the spice blend to your taste or experiment with flavors like nutmeg, ginger, or allspice.
5. How should I store leftover cake?
Store leftover cake in an airtight container in the fridge for up to five days, or freeze it for longer storage.
